A discussion on how to reposition IT as a game player in aligning technology expectations and perceptions between faculty and students and why this will only succeed when the university’s business strategy and IT’s agenda are inclusive.

Do faculty and students perceive technology equally? The digital transformation of higher education has erupted the fabric of traditional models. To remain competitive, universities need to adapt their processes to keep abreast and reach out to a younger, more technologically minded consumer, often posing great challenges especially to faculty and staff. As technology advances and new trends emerge, we need to re-position IT as a game player in aligning technology perceptions between faculty/staff and students. To do this with success the IT’s digital agenda must be in-line with the business strategy of the university.
